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3
The NM_001378271.1(RNASEH1):c.815G>A(p.Arg272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000161 in 1,612,848 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

This variant has not been reported in the literature in individuals affected with RNASEH1-related conditions. This variant is present in population databases (rs778030645, gnomAD 0.02%). This sequence change affects codon 265 of the RNASEH1 mRNA. It is a 'silent' change, meaning that it does not change the encoded amino acid sequence of the RNASEH1 protein. Algorithms developed to predict the effect of sequence changes on RNA splicing suggest that this variant may create or strengthen a splice site.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
